Earn twice the savings starting Sept. 16

PORTLAND, ME – Override, a network of respected retailers throughout New England that offers gas savings directly to consumers, is offering some good news to offset the end-of-summer blues.

Beginning Sept. 16, participating Dunkin’ Donuts locations are offering “double rewards” to their customers participating in the Override program.  For every $20 purchased with a Dunkin’ Donuts Card, customers participating in the Override program may now receive 8 cents off the price of a gallon of Irving gas. The offer is good until Sept. 30, and the extra savings can be redeemed at more than 160 Irving locations throughout New England until Oct. 14, subject to the terms and conditions of the Override program.

“As customers switch from iced coffee to hot coffee drinks, we thought we’d celebrate the end of summer and the beginning of a great fall here in Maine and New Hampshire,” said Harry Hadiaris, Director of Operations for Irving Oil. “A visit to the local Dunkin’s is part of a great morning routine for thousands of people, and we wanted to brighten it up just a little bit more.”

There are 149 Dunkin’ locations throughout Maine, with a small number in New Hampshire, participating in the Override gas savings program.

The Override network of retailers has included Irving and Shaw’s Supermarkets since July 2007. Dunkin’ Donuts joined the program in the spring of 2008.

About Dunkin’ Donuts Maine
Maine consumers have consistently voted Dunkin’ Donuts as having Maine’s “Best Coffee” in numerous polls and surveys. Founded in 1950, today Dunkin’ Donuts is the number one retailer of coffee by the cup in America, selling 2.7 million cups a day, nearly one billion cups a year. Dunkin’ Donuts is also the largest coffee and baked goods chain in the world and sells more donuts, coffee and bagels than any other quick service restaurant in America. Dunkin’ Donuts has more than 6,700 shops in 29 countries worldwide. Based in Canton, Massachusetts, Dunkin’ Donuts is a subsidiary of Dunkin’ Brands, Inc. About Irving Oil
Founded in 1924, Irving Oil is a regional refining and marketing company serving customers in New England and Eastern Canada with a range of finished energy products, including gasoline, diesel, home heating fuel, jet fuel and complementary products and services. In 2003, Irving Oil became the first oil company to win a USEPA Clean Air Excellence award for its low sulphur gasoline. For more information, visit www.irvingoil.com.
